INTRODUCTION

INKSCAPE is an Open Source Vector graphics editor similar to Adobe Illustrator, CorelDraw or Xara X, which uses the W3C standard Scalable Vector Graphics (SVG) file format.

Inkscape can create and edit complex vector graphics and save them in a variety of formats. These illustrations and drawings may be used for Desktop Publishing, in your presentations and documents. Thus it may benefit everyone who requires graphics for presentations or any type of document. In particular it will be very useful for the graphic designer, web designer and the desktop publisher. There are no pre-requisites for learning Inkscape.

The current stable version of Inkscape is 0.48.1. Inkscape may be used under all flavours of Linux, Windows and Mac Operating Systems.
